Those calls Eric has are special run DC's. That's why he's asking the $$$ for those.

They changed the toneboard the year they came out with the scroll work. I bought four and sent all four back for modifying. They still weren't like the first run crossbones with the plain insert. I've been offered $500 for my ivory 2nd Gen. I'm the fool that sold 6 of mine for $100 each a month before that first one got crazy bids on ebay and took off like wildfire. John's reply on a FB duck call group when questioned recently about this new DC re-make.



John Stephens- To answer y'all's question yes they are an exact replica. Now whether it is an exact of the osdc you have I don't know. There we're so many versions of the tone board. What we have done is picked out a few of the osdc we like from the scroll and dc crest version and digitized them here in the shop. These calls are owned by different hunters we know that have been using this version since we made them. We have passed them around the shop and will replicate the consensus winner. We hope the one we choose everyone will like as well, but we know that is impossible due to the fact this call has so many different versions floating around. When you do receive yours please message me or e-mail your thoughts, likes, dislikes, we always like getting feedback. We should finishing barrels today and start cutting inserts tonight. Hopefully all will be done Friday afternoon latest Monday Am. Thanks for your patience and interest! God bless! -John Stephens
